I am here giving instructions to do or not to do while you are in this situation:

 

Instructions for girls:

  1. Your security is in your hands only; no one will be there for you while you are facing the situation. Government is not bound or liable for your security they will give justice to you, that’s it.
  2. Keep a pepper’s spray or chilli or knife with you. A girl can keep lips stick or some make up kit with her, that girl can atleast keep these things also, it is not a big deal. Nobody will teach you how you’ll use this. But as and when situation come, you’ll learn automatically.
  3. Spare 10-20 minutes for awareness in this situation on internet. If you can use internet for accessing facebook then it is not big issue.
  4. Do whatever you can, first ran away from the spot. Use the above things, there is law and regulation system in our country only for justice, but that justice will be very slow and I personally think that for a girl respect is not just a word.
  5. We all know our judicial system is very slow, sometime polices deny to take the FIR also, force them to do. Otherwise, the suspects will not at all will be arrested.
  6. Most importantly, try to recognize the people, don’t give freedom to boys for doing anything phishy, don’t try to excite them. Sorry to say but here, I dint highlight girls mentality. Some boys are like that. Girls should recognize them.
